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93 191 719
11416485862 30 45789316
11416485862 30 45789316
7354 50 088 4188543 9428483327
All about undefined
Interested in learning more?
11416485862 30 45789316
7354 50 088 4188543 9428483327
See more
994310333 13939834737 6257
426 8848 96297623929 2235020 49553
See more
7511071968 732627
86889 984 81468010
See more